What is OCR (optical character recognition)?

Have you ever wondered how computers can magically understand the text in scanned documents or images? That’s the marvel of Optical Character Recognition, Let’s delve into the enchanting world of OCR and discover its secrets.

What is OCR?

OCR, short for Optical Character Recognition, is a fascinating technology that allows computers to recognize and interpret text from various sources, including scanned documents, images, and even handwritten notes. It’s like teaching computers to read and understand text, just like we humans do.

How Does Optical Character Recognition Work?

Imagine you have a handwritten letter that you want to convert into digital text. Here’s how OCR works its magic:

Firstly, the image of the handwritten letter is captured using a scanner or a camera. Then, the OCR software gets to work by analyzing the image. It identifies different regions that contain text and separates them from other elements.

Next, OCR breaks down the text into individual characters or groups of characters, a bit like solving a puzzle! It examines the shapes, patterns, and spacing between characters to figure out what each letter or number represents.

After deciphering the characters, OCR matches them against a database of known characters, similar to how we might match a jigsaw piece to its rightful place in a puzzle. Once the characters are recognized, they are converted into editable and searchable text.

Optical Character Recognition Use Cases

The wonders of OCR extend far and wide, with countless real-world applications. Here are just a few examples:

  1. Document Digitization: OCR makes it possible to convert paper documents into digital format quickly and accurately. This is invaluable for businesses, libraries, and individuals looking to organize and archive their documents.
  2. Data Entry Automation: Instead of manually entering data from forms or invoices, OCR can automate the process by extracting text from scanned documents. This saves time, reduces errors, and streamlines workflow efficiency.
  3. Accessibility: OCR plays a vital role in making printed materials accessible to visually impaired individuals. By converting printed text into digital format, OCR enables text-to-speech software and Braille displays to make the content accessible.
  4. Automatic Number Plate Recognition : Law enforcement agencies and transportation authorities use OCR to automatically read and interpret license plate numbers from images captured by surveillance cameras. This helps in tasks such as traffic monitoring, toll collection, and vehicle tracking.
  5. Language Translation: OCR can facilitate language translation by converting text from one language into another. This is particularly useful for translating documents, signage, and printed materials in multilingual environments.
